Default Can anyone explain this to me?

I'm playing the frst mission (Opening Moves) in the Operation Rough seas campaign. I am commanding the Seawolf. The objective is to escort my battlegroup into safe territory. I submerged quite deep to about 2000 ft. hit sped at flank and sped ahead to check ot an unusual contact. I suspected it was a submarine. I classified it as a Kilo. We are loking to take out any Islamics who may be hoping to take down our fleet. Bottomline: wo knows what kind of sub they may be using. I slowed rose to about 130 ft, launched a UUV, and kept tabs on him. Ke kept inching slowly toward the battlegroup, so I thought...Ok I've seen enough. I launced a couple of torpedos at him. one of them hit...(although I don't know whaen you hit a sub or ship, you still continue to receve contact information asthough it were still there) With that I hear multiple torpedos in the water in te direction of my own battlegroup, so I though no way would they fire on me!!! A minte or so later I'm sinking to the bottom after being hit with an MK50 Torpedo. As it turns out the sub I killed was a Chineese Han, not a KILO, but still....what exactly happened here? did myown fleet reallyput me down? If so, why????

I've been fired on by friendly AI surface forces before, in a MP dive no less.

I fired an ADCAP at a certain person on this forum about 14nm away (which killed him after I died... ) when I was about 500 yards away from a Spruance and it immediately put a MK50 in the water and I died before i could figure out exactly what had happened.

If friendly surface ships are in a hostile posture and are prosecuting submarines and you happen to be near them and fire torpedoes, about 50% of the time they will snapshot torpedoes down the bearing of your TIW.

So you have to be very careful about firing torpedoes around friendly surface forces when they have detected hostile submerged contacts in their vicinity.
